That seems a bit extreme.  On an average day, lots of 80m, 40m, and even 
upper HF band activity already tends toward being channelized to the 
nearest 1 KHz, and if anything it helps spread out the QSO's.  All that 
goes by the wayside (as it should)  when activity picks up for contests 
and DX pileups.

Besides, whatever influence the -->OPTION<-- for 0.5 KHz spacing in the 
K3 may have on channelization, it is more than offset by the K3's 
excellent narrow filter capability.
